Turkey liverwurst is a delicious and healthy alternative to traditional beef liverwurst. Made with turkey, a leaner protein source, this spread is lower in fat and calories and higher in protein and iron. It is also a good source of vitamins A, B12, and D, making it a nutritious addition to your diet.
